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
OpenLink Endur
- No pricing published on vendor website; enterprise product requires direct contact with ION Group sales
Wood Mackenzie Lens
- Licensing is per named seat and per dataset, so sharing a login across an analyst team breaches the contract and licensing the team properly multiplies the fee rather than adding to it.
- The content is analyst-modelled rather than operator-reported, so asset economics and reserve figures are estimates and can differ materially from what the owner of the asset publishes.
- Modules are split by commodity and by region, and a question that spans gas and power, or Americas and EMEA, can require two or three separate subscriptions to answer.
- Content refresh follows the research publication calendar, so individual asset records can lag a transaction or a project decision by a quarter or more, which matters on live deals.
- Ownership passed from Verisk to Veritas Capital in 2023, so buyers signing multi-year terms are contracting with a private equity holding whose plans for pricing and packaging are not public.

SourceWood Mackenzie Lens: Am I buying software or research?
Research. Lens is the delivery platform for Wood Mackenzie analysis, and the analysis is what the price reflects.

SourceWood Mackenzie Lens: Who owns Wood Mackenzie?
Veritas Capital, which acquired it from Verisk in 2023.
Wood Mackenzie Lens: Can a team share one licence?
No. Licences are per named user, and sharing breaches the subscription terms.
Wood Mackenzie Lens: Can I get the data into my own models?
Yes, through Lens Direct, which is licensed separately from platform access.
